The reintroduction of the Payment Systems Protection Act

 

Barney Frank, the U.S. Congressman, in effort to overturn the 2006 UIGEA, reintroduced his “Payment Systems Protection Act of 2008”. Frank himself, who is the chairman of the House Financial Services, considers the Unlawful Internet Gambling Enforcement Act a very stupid law and he is amazed about the fact that such a law could have ever passed. He already tried to bring up anti-UIGEA legislation, with the bill HR5767, but because of the committee vote, he didn’t succeed.

In the latest edition of Frank’s bill, he criticise directly the UIGEA. The US federal agencies which are responsible for the implementation of the UIGEA are the Department of the Treasury and the Financial Reserve Board. The HR 6870, the new bill, will try to prohibit these two US federal agencies to extend the UIGEA’s reach beyond the outlawed areas, like for example sports wagering. Besides, Frank tries to suspend the current UIGEA code with his HR 6870 bill until an administrative law judge works with the two responsible federal agencies and develops some workable regulations.

The current Unlawful Internet Gambling Enforcement Act places an unfunded mandate to the US banking system to block many internet related gambling transactions.
Frank fights against the UIGEA with his bill and he already found his first co-sponsor for his bill, Rep. Peter King.
